Archaeologists uncover remains of a Maroon community that lived in a forgotten Virginia swamp; lost artifacts are exposed at Harriet Tubman’s childhood home; and experts explore a cemetery where Freedom Seekers hid amidst the dead in Washington DC.

Underground Railroad: The Secret History is a four-part documentary series that uses archaeology and modern technology to unlock some of the biggest mysteries surrounding this secret network that helped enslaved people escape to freedom.
